Planning and Production location's CIF issue

Former Member
0 Kudos

Hi ,

As per client business scenario, we have 2 PDS for the same material (1 PDS i.e. Planning and Production Location is same & 2PDS i.e. Planning location is same as above but have diff production location).

For a material having planning location and diff production location, we need to maintained Sp. Procurement Type (80. i.e. Production at Alternative plant).

In our case 2 PDS gets transfer at APO side, planning run is giving results as per our requirements.

The issue is with CIF: Planned Order queues

i.e. As we have maintained Sp. Procurement Type = 80, the planned orderu2019s having planning location and diff production location is moving to ECC, But those planned order having same planning and production location gets struck in the queue with an Master Data error.

Whether anyone have worked in such type of scenario, this queueu2019s issue can be resolve with any settingu2019s that I am missing or some configuration changes required to be done at ECC side to resolve this queues error.

The orders created for production at same location is indeed in conflict with your special procurement key in ECC. You already specified in your material master that the production is for a different location and the order you are sending is finding this conflict. I think the design is simply in conflict with the SAP standard design.
